Output 96081cc4bc0248f128fdd850aba5fe35e620ae3cb104cadecc28056bb23908fd:6

value
10322855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ddf3287f939991e81e07c8994c438935796a1f OP_EQUAL
address
3L16xFjZFELfbyWTwucvXpBcXPt8aGRqGT
transaction
96081cc4bc0248f128fdd850aba5fe35e620ae3cb104cadecc28056bb23908fd
confirmations
300364
spent
true